Professional WCF 4: Windows Communication Foundation with .NET 4
John Wiley and Sons Ltd, June 2010, Pages: 480
A guide to architecting, designing, and building distributed applications with Windows Communication Foundation
Windows Communication Foundation is the .NET technology that is used to build service-oriented applications, exchange messages in various communication scenarios, and run workflows. This guide enables developers to create state-of-the-art applications using this technology.
Written by a team of Microsoft MVPs and WCF experts, this book explains how the pieces of WCF 4.0 build on each other to provide a comprehensive framework to support distributed enterprise applications. Experienced developers will learn both theory and practical application using the familiar Wrox approach.
.NET developers will learn to design services, create a hosting environment with Dublin, build cloud-based integrations, and much more.
Coverage Includes:
- Design Principles and Patterns - Service Contracts and Data Contracts - Bindings - Clients - Instancing - Workflow Services - Understanding WCF Security - WCF Security in Action - Federated Authentication in WCF - Windows Azure Platform AppFabric - Creating a SOA Case - Creating the Communication and Integration Case - Creating the Business Process - Hosting
